  • The Imperial County Office of Education (ICOE) Foundation for Education, the county schools’ nonprofit arm which exists to support local educational programs, hosted its second annual Autumn & the Arts fundraiser here on October 6 to raise funds for local students’ education. The event showcased about 25 high school student-made art from around Imperial County schools, with interested art-supporters sometimes buying pieces in auction or silent auction.   • The Imperial County Public Health Department (ICPHD) has launched a joint mental health awareness billboard campaign in partnership with the Imperial County Office of Education (ICOE), Imperial County Behavioral Health Services (ICBHS), and Imperial County School-Based Mental Health Consortium. Funded through ICPHD’s Safe Schools for All program, this campaign aims at raising awareness about mental health, improving access to services, and reducing the stigma of mental illness.

  • Imperial County Teacher of the Year is Mayra Armenta Imperial County – Sixth grade teacher from the El Centro Elementary School District, Mayra Armenta, has been selected as the Imperial County Teacher of the Year for this coming school year.
